Since there is no universal sizing system for body jewelry, we recommend checking with your local piercer to find out the appropriate gauge and length. If that's not possible, we've listed some guidelines below. These are suggestions only. The size of a piece of body jewelry is determined by its gauge, length, and inside diameter. The gauge is the thickness of the jewelry shaft. The smaller the gauge number, the thicker the jewelry is. We’ve made a handy chart for your reference.
Size | Decimal Conversion | Millimeters |
---|---|---|
20 | .032 | .812 |
18 | .040 | 1.02 |
16 | .051 | 1.29 |
14 | .064 | 1.63 |
12 | .081 | 2.05 |
10 | .102 | 2.59 |
8 | .128 | 3 |
6 | .162 | 4 |
4 | .204 | 5 |
2 | .257 | 6 |
0 | .325 | 8 |
00 | .365 | 9 |
7/16 | .4375 | 11 |
1/2 | .500 | 12 |
9/16 | .5625 | 14 |
5/8 | .625 | 16 |
3/4 | .750 | 19 |
7/8 | .875 | 22 |
1 | 1.000 | 25 |
Unless stated otherwise in the product description, you will always receive a pair of plugs or tunnels.

We highly recommend chatting up your local piercer. Professional piercers use surgical stainless steel and titanium initially because they are hypoallergenic. These are the best materials to prevent any reactions to the object in your body! Once a new piercing heals, you can play around with different materials and styles.

Technically anything larger than a standard ear piercing which is 18 gauge (1.0 mm) is considered a stretch. If you’re wanting to wear plugs or tunnels most jewelry will start at an 8 gauge.
This depends on multiple factors. If you are stretching your ears properly with tapers, taking your time and allowing them to heal fully before you go up to your next size, without skipping sizes, your ears will stretch easily and be healthy with little to no scar tissue, allowing the hole to close up if you decide to take out your jewelry. Different people have different natural elasticity depending on their body type but as long as you allow the stretching process to be very natural your ear lobes should shrink up immensely if you choose to let them heal.
This is just the universal way the tapers work. Going from a 2 gauge to a 0 gauge is the first stretch that jumps from the previous 1mm stretches you're used to and everything after will be that 2mm jump. This means to be extra careful when doing your stretch go very slow and use some Tru Jelly (a lubricant we sell designed specifically to promote the natural elasticity in your skin to make an easier stretch).
Once your lobes are done healing they will not hurt, they will just feel like your regular lobes again!
Silicone is extremely dangerous to stretch with because instead of gradually stretching your skin like a taper (our recommendation), you are snapping your skin open to the next size which can cause a blow out, a tear, or worse - rip your entire hole. Plus, silicone is an unfriendly material to place in a healing piercing; it can actually start to bind to your skin and cause further damage when removed.
A rejecting piercing will look like the jewelry is trying to make its way out of your skin. This can happen because you’re putting a foreign object in your body, and naturally your body will start to fight the object by pushing it out and healing behind it to eventually force the object completely out of the skin.
A keloid is a tough bump of scar tissue that can occur most commonly in a piercing through cartilage. The best treatment we recommend is diligently using Dragon Mist. This is an all-natural topical spray with a key ingredient of tea tree oil that helps minimize and shrink the keloid bump whilst still properly cleaning your jewelry. With repeated and proper use the keloid should eventually go away.
The best thing to do is to go to a professional piercer and get them to use tapered needle to open your current piercing up to the proper gauge you need for your jewelry. Tapering shouldn’t cost as much, won’t hurt and will be a shorter healing period than the original piercing.
The smell you experience from stretched ears is because you’ll get a buildup of skin oils and dead skin cells (ear cheese) that “gunks” up your jewelry. As your ears get larger you’ll notice it gets worse because, well, there’s more surface area of skin. We sell a product called Smelly Gelly, a petroleum based piercing conditioner that you can use once every 1-2 weeks (a little goes a long way!) to prevent the smell. Provided you’re still cleaning your jewelry of course!
There are so many things wrong with getting gun piercings that we could go on forever, but basically the gun forces a blunt stud through the skin creating a jagged hole that can take a long time to heal, and can also be extremely inaccurate or crooked. It’s also extremely unsterile, and more painful than a needle.
Getting pierced with a needle by a professional will ensure that all of their instruments are properly sterilized. The needle they use is extremely sharp and hollow, allowing it safely pierce the skin and pushing the tissue to the side so the jewelry can be inserted safely. This method is almost painless and will give you much better results for healing and wearing your jewelry afterwards.

We always recommend to use a basic anti-bacterial soap and warm water, a sea salt water solution, or saline solution. It is best to stay away from anything that contains alcohol or peroxide as this can be potentially damaging to your jewelry and can also dry out your skin when used.

A blow out is caused from stretching too quickly. Basically when you’re pushing a taper through and your lobe is not quite ready to stretch the pressure that your putting on your ear lobe by trying to force the taper through will cause the bottom part of your hole to rip and release the pressure. Your ear lobe will look like it’s starting to turn inside out. To avoid this happening be patient and make sure you’re not stretching too quickly, it’s not a race. Stretching is supposed to be as natural as possible if you’re experiencing a lot of pain or bleeding that’s your body telling you it’s not ready to stretch yet, stay at your current size and try stretching again down the road.
